On This Web Page: Vieux-Montreal (Old Montreal) Old Montral is vacationer main in Montral. The location is home to an impressive concentration of structures dating from the 17th, 18th, and 19th centuries and has the wonderful feeling of a Parisian-style quarter. Many of these historical buildings are currently hotels, dining establishments, galleries, and souvenir shops.

View of Montreal from Mont Royal Mont-Royal increases 233 meters above the city and is the environment-friendly lung near the city center. A stroll with this charming park enables the site visitor to see monuments to Jacques Cartier and King George VI. Be sure to invest a long time by Lac-aux-Castors, and to have a look at the cemeteries on the western slope where the city's various ethnic teams have actually rested in tranquility with each other for centuries

The twin towers of the neo-Gothic faade face. The detailed and magnificent interior was made by Victor Bourgeau. Emphasizes are the amazing sculpted pulpit by sculptor Louis-Philippe Hbert (1850-1917), the 7,000-pipe organ by the Casavant Frres firm, and the stained-glass windows depicting scenes from the founding of Montreal. The admission charge to the basilica consists of a 20-minute trip, or you can take a one-hour tour that offers much more historical information and accessibility to private locations, including the 2nd porch and crypt.


Joseph's Oratory) The Oratoire Saint-Joseph, near the western exit from Mount Royal Park, is committed to Canada's tutelary saint. It is a mecca for explorers, with its significant Renaissance-style domed basilica dating to 1924. Brother Andr of the Congrgation de Sainte-Croix had actually currently constructed a tiny church right here in 1904, where he did miraculous acts of healing for which he was canonized in 1982.

Chinatown Montral's Chinatown is focused on Rue de la Gauchetire, with Chinese entrances noting the heart of the quarter. This vivid area dates from the late 1860s, when a number of the Chinese workers, that originally came to function in the mines and develop the railway, relocated right into the cities in search of a much better life.
